    Measurements of turbulent flow in a horizontal pipe subjected to wall transpiration are presented. Results include data on global flow rates and pressure drop, and local mean and fluctuating velocity profiles. Two distinct flow transpiration rates are studied, vw++v_w^{++} = vwv_w/UmU_m = 0.0005 and 0.001. The effects of flow transpiration on the friction-coefficient are compared with theoretical predictions. The theory furnishes predictions accurate to 3\%

    The characteristic near wall behavior of turbulent flow of purely-viscous non-Newtonian fluids is discussed for both power-law (P.-L.) and Herschel-Bulkley (H.-B.) rheological models. A proper scaling is presented for H.-B. fluids to establish an analogy with power-law fluids with same flow index. To provide reference data for turbulent flow of non-Newtonian fluids, DNS simulations of power-law fluids are conducted in a rectangular channel for a large range of power-law indices (nn = 0.5, 0.69, 0.75, 0.9, 1, 1.2). The DNS data show that the mean velocity profile in the viscous and logarithmic layers follow expressions of the form u+=y+u^{+}=y^{+} and u+=2.5log(y+)+Bnu^{+}=2.5\,log(y^{+})+B_{n} respectively, where BB shows a logarithmic dependency on the flow index.Comparison with some experimental data shows the above formulation to be valid for Reynolds numbers (based on shear velocity) as high as 1000

    With the recent transposition of Directive 2010/53/EU into the transplant regulation of EU Member States, the time is right to have a closer look at its implications for living organ donation practice. We first discuss the relevance of the Action Plan which forms the basis for the policy of the European Commission in the field of organ donation and transplantation. We then analyze the impact of Directive 2010/53/EU which was adopted to support the implementation of the Priority Actions set out in the Action Plan. We more specifically focus on the obligations of transplant centers engaged in living organ donation and highlight their significance for clinical practice. Finally, we point out some strengths and weaknesses of the Directive in addressing living organ donation

    The article considers the study of the scientific heritage of the outstanding Soviet archaeologist Aleksei Petrovich Smirnov, the founder of the scientific direction in the archaeology of the Volga-Kama region – Bulgaristics. Of particular interest are the scientific works of the researcher, which have become classic: "The Volga Bolgars" and "Essays on the ancient and medieval history of the peoples in the Middle Volga and the Kama regions" published in 1951 and 1952 respectively. In the first book, the author gives a detailed description not only of the social, economic and political events in the history of Volga Bolgaria within the formation approach, but also of the material culture of its population. The peculiarity of this part of A.P. Smirnov's research is that there is no typological classification here, although A.P. Smirnov uses its basic principles very often. The author claims that this was the result of the "Marxisation" of archaeological science carried out in the USSR in the 1930s, when the typological method was considered bourgeois and unsuitable for the Soviet history of material culture, as archaeology came to be called. A.P. Smirnov, well-versed in the typological method developed by his teacher V.A. Gorodtsov, deliberately limited its use. At the same time, he successfully applied the results of studies in the 1920s by his colleagues-archaeologists – A.V. Artsikhovsky, S.V. Kiselyov, V.V. Golmsten, and others, concerning the general analysis of the subject world in the context of social history. Smirnov, in the book "The Volga Bolgars", laid the foundations for further scientific developments of his students in the field of Bulgaristics, for example, T.A. Khlebnikova.     Reading and language disorders are common childhood conditions that often co-occur with each other and with other neurodevelopmental impairments. There is strong evidence that disorders, such as dyslexia and Specific Language Impairment (SLI), have a genetic basis, but we expect the contributing genetic factors to be complex in nature. To date, only a few genes have been implicated in these traits. Their functional characterization has provided novel insight into the biology of neurodevelopmental disorders. However, the lack of biological markers and clear diagnostic criteria have prevented the collection of the large sample sizes required for well-powered genome-wide screens.
